According to the composition of the core material, the cored wire can be meticulously categorized into single and composite cored wires:
1) Single cored wire: This type of cored wire features a singular alloy powder or powdery nonmetallic compound additive as its core material.
2) Composite cored wire: This type of cored wire incorporates two or more alloy powders as its core material, enhancing versatility and performance.
The cored wire can be neatly divided into inner tap type and outer tap type based on the arrangement of the wire.
Primarily utilized to purify steel impurities and enhance the overall quality of molten steel, our cored wires significantly improve casting conditions, castability, and service performance. They also substantially increase the alloy yield, reduce alloy consumption, and lower steelmaking costs.
